Publication number: 20170021665Abstract: A threaded connection body (20) is welded to the outer surface of the wall (10) of a pipe, seachest or other flooded cavity (4) within the hull of a ship or floating off-shore installation. A sealed cutting apparatus (50) is mounted via a valve unit (30) on the connection body and a cutter extended through the open valve (34) to form an opening (18) in the wall (10). After retracting the cutter and closing the valve (34), the cutting apparatus is replaced by a sealed inspection unit (70) having a camera (71) which is extended through the valve and the opening to inspect the cavity (4). After retracting the camera and closing the valve, the inspection unit is replaced by a plug deployment unit (100) which is used to advance a plug (120) through the open valve and screw it into the connection body (20). The valve unit (30) can then be removed and replaced with a cap (90) so that the plug and the cap provide a double seal to the connection body.Type: ApplicationFiled: November 27, 2014Publication date: January 26, 2017Applicant: EM&I (MARITIME) LIMITEDInventor: Danny Constantinis

Publication number: 20170021684Abstract: A ball mount for measuring tongue weight of a trailer is disclosed. The ball mount can comprise a ball portion for interfacing with a ball configured to couple with a tongue of a trailer, a hitch portion for interfacing with a hitch receiver associated with a vehicle, and a load measurement device associated with the hitch portion. The hitch portion can be configured to pivot relative to the hitch receiver about a fulcrum in response to a downward force on the ball, with the hitch receiver resisting rotation of the hitch portion about the fulcrum thereby inducing a load on the hitch portion. The load measurement device can be configured to determine a magnitude of the downward force on the ball based on the load on the hitch portion.Type: ApplicationFiled: May 3, 2016Publication date: January 26, 2017Inventor: Kevin McAllister

Publication number: 20170021688Abstract: A vehicle height adjustment device includes an actuator, a detector, and a controller. The actuator is driven when supplied with a current and is configured to change a relative position of a body of a vehicle relative to an axle of a wheel of the vehicle. The detector is configured to detect the relative position. The controller is configured to control the current supplied to the actuator to make the relative position a target value so as to adjust a vehicle height of the body. When a detection value of the detector is smaller than the target value of the relative position, the controller is configured to alternately supply an increase current and a maintenance current to the actuator. The increase current increases the relative position to increase the vehicle height. The maintenance current maintains the relative position to maintain the vehicle height.Type: ApplicationFiled: July 6, 2016Publication date: January 26, 2017Applicant: Showa CorporationInventors: Yosuke MURAKAMI, Fumiaki ISHIKAWA, Hiroyuki MIYATA

Publication number: 20170021691Abstract: A steel, having a high corrosion resistance and low-temperature toughness, for a vehicle suspension spring part, the steel includes 0.21 to 0.35% by mass of C, more than 0.6% by mass but 1.5% by mass or less of Si, 1 to 3% by mass of Mn, 0.3 to 0.8% by mass of Cr, 0.005 to 0.080% by mass of sol. Al, 0.005 to 0.060% by mass of Ti, 0.005 to 0.060% by mass of Nb, not more than 150 ppm of N, not more than 0.035% by mass of P, not more than 0.035% by mass of S, 0.01 to 1.00% by mass of Cu, and 0.01 to 1.00% by mass of Ni, the balance being Fe and unavoidable impurities, with Ti+Nb?0.07% by mass, wherein crystal grains of the steel after hardening have a prior austenite grain size number of 7.5 to 10.5, and the steel having a tensile strength of not less than 1,300 MPa.Type: ApplicationFiled: September 26, 2016Publication date: January 26, 2017Applicants: NHK SPRING CO., LTD., JFE BARS & SHAPES CORPORATIONInventors: Akira TANGE, Kiyoshi KURIMOTO, Yurika GOTO, Katsuhiko KIKUCHI, Kunikazu TOMITA, Kazuaki FUKUOKA, Kazuaki HATTORI
